A new analysis in Science of more than 116,000 bird songs has revealed that the astonishing variety of passerine birdsong is built from just eight basic acoustic motifs, like trills, whistles, and harmonic notes. https://scim.ag/4ft2KBF

The global biogeography of passerine songs

Although bird songs are classic models for understanding the evolution of vocal communication, their global diversity has long made the development of a unifying framework challenging. By analyzing th...
